https://residential.jll.co.uk/JLL's new Nine Elms residential office opened its doors in August 2015 and is ideally located within Riverlight Quay, the sought after St James development situated directly opposite the traditional architecture of fashionable Kensington and Chelsea, with an enviable position on the south bank of the River Thames. Nine Elms is home to the iconic Battersea Power Station, Vista, Aykon, Embassy Gardens and many more to come as well as the new location of the American Embassy. The area is set to rival the Capital’s most exclusive shopping zones with worldwide superbrands signing up to the commercial opportunities and a zone 1 Underground station opening in 2020.
